Chicken Pad Thai

258 kcal per 100 g, with 14.1 g protein, 36.7 g carbs and 6.2 g fat. Full micronutrients and serving info below.

Common questions

How many calories are in Chicken Pad Thai?

Chicken Pad Thai by Pulmuone has 258 kcal per 100 g.

How much protein is in Chicken Pad Thai?

Chicken Pad Thai contains 14.1 g of protein per 100 g.

Is Chicken Pad Thai a good source of protein?

Yes — 14.1 g of protein per 100 g, supplying 22% of its calories. That makes it a good protein source.

Is Chicken Pad Thai high in sodium?

Yes — 929.7 mg of sodium per 100 g, about 40% of the daily value.

Why does Chicken Pad Thai have a Nutri-Score of C?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from sugar (11.7 g), sodium (929.7 mg); points in favor come from protein (14.1 g). Overall that places it in band C.

How much Chicken Pad Thai is 100 calories?

About 39 g of Chicken Pad Thai equals 100 kcal.

Is Chicken Pad Thai high in sugar or fat?

Per 100 g it has 11.7 g sugar and 6.2 g fat (0.8 g saturated). Fat provides 21% of its calories, so portion size matters most here.
